It just came across NBC News: January 7th is the hardest day of the year to get out of bed. A depression has set in.
There are four reasons.

1) Christmas and  New Year are behind us. The celebrations are over..
2) The bills for our over-spending in November and December have arrived on the kitchen table.
3)Winter is here in earnest. It is frigid outside and the car is in the driveway covered in snow.
4)Work and the prospect of another six months without vacation awaits us.
There is a powerful urge to pull the sheets over our head and stay where we are in bed.
